Three Arrested for Copper Wire Theft 

December 2, 2025 – Placer County Sheriff’s Office officials report that on Sunday, November 30th, the Placer County Sheriff’s Office arrested three individuals connected to a copper wire theft in a new development area of West Roseville near Bluebell Lane and Royal Lily Avenue.

Callers reported suspicious activity in the area after hearing the sound of power tools. They also noticed a white BMW parked near the location where the suspects appeared to be cutting wire.

Deputies responded to the area and located a vehicle matching the description on Baseline Road, approximately three miles from the area that the theft occurred. A traffic stop was conducted, and the three occupants were identified. During a search of the vehicle, deputies located brass valves, copper pipes, copper wire, and power tools believed to be used in the theft.

All three suspects were arrested and booked into the South Placer Jail on theft-related charges.

Arrested:

Carissa Avila, 36

Martin Barron Acosta, 44

Rigoberto Velasquez, 32

Thanks to quick reporting from the community and the attentive work of our deputies, these suspects were quickly caught.
